file-type

GPSR 6.0l1算法在Matlab中的实现

版权申诉

ZIP文件

5星 · 超过95%的资源 | 1.52MB | 更新于2024-10-20 | 111 浏览量 | 8 评论 | 2 下载量 举报 1 收藏
download 限时特惠:#19.90
是一个指向特定版本的GPSR算法的参考资源。GPSR代表贪婪坐标下降算法(Greedy Perimeter Stateless Routing),这是一种用于无线网络中路由信息的算法。在文件"GPSR_6.0"中,重点是GPSR的6.0版本实现,具体为l1有化算法在Matlab环境下的实现。 GPSR算法被设计用于在无线网络中高效地传递数据包。在无线网络中,节点间的通信可能会因为信号衰减、干扰以及其他物理层面的问题而变得复杂。路由算法需要决定数据包应该通过哪个中间节点才能到达目标节点。GPSR算法特别适合于基于地理位置信息的路由决策。 "l1有化算法"可能是指特定的算法优化,这里"l1"可能指的是L1范数最小化问题,在数学和计算机科学中,L1范数通常与线性规划问题中的稀疏性相关联。在GPSR算法的上下文中,L1有化可能涉及到寻找一种路径,该路径不仅能够到达目的地,而且能够最小化某些成本函数,比如通过路径上的节点数量。这样的优化通常有利于降低延迟和提升网络的效率。 Matlab是一种广泛使用的高性能数值计算和可视化软件,它提供了大量的工具箱来支持各种工程、科学和数学计算。Matlab在算法开发和研究方面尤其受到欢迎,因为它允许用户快速编写脚本和函数,进行原型设计和分析。在GPSR_6.0的文件中,作者可能提供了用Matlab编写的GPSR算法的实现代码,包括l1有化算法的特定实现。 GPSR算法的工作原理主要包括两个步骤:贪婪转发和强制转发。在贪婪转发阶段,每个节点根据自己的位置和目的地的位置信息,选择距离目的地最近的邻居节点进行转发。当遇到局部最小问题,即周围没有比当前节点更接近目标的邻居节点时,GPSR会切换到强制转发模式,利用沿多边形边界的策略绕过障碍物,继续向目的地前进。 使用Matlab实现GPSR算法可以带来几个好处。首先,Matlab的矩阵操作和绘图功能非常适合处理复杂的网络拓扑和路由问题。其次,Matlab的仿真能力允许研究人员能够快速验证算法的效果,并对算法参数进行调整。最后,Matlab的可视化工具可以辅助研究人员更直观地理解和分析路由过程。 在研究和开发无线网络路由协议时,参考类似"GPSR_6.0 (2)_GPSR"这样的资源是非常有价值的。它们不仅提供了一种可能的算法实现,而且还可能包含了对算法性能的评估和测试结果。这些信息对于研究人员和工程师来说是宝贵的,有助于他们改进算法、优化网络性能,或将其应用于特定的网络场景中。由于"GPSR_6.0"是一个压缩文件,它可能包含了一些代码文件、测试用例、文档说明以及可能的仿真结果。对于打算深入研究GPSR算法的个人,这是一个值得探索的重要资源。

相关推荐

资源评论
用户头像
練心
2025.06.11
对于使用matlab进行GPSR算法研究的专业人士来说,这份资源提供了高效的实现方案。
用户头像
AshleyK
2025.06.02
文档资源提供的GPSR 6.0针对l1有化算法的实现在matlab中操作简洁,值得参考。
用户头像
H等等H
2025.04.24
此资源能够帮助专业人士快速理解和掌握GPSR 6.0在matlab中的具体应用。
用户头像
型爷
2025.04.20
内容详实,通过此文档可以了解到GPSR 6.0算法在matlab中的最新进展。
用户头像
白小俗
2025.04.02
对于需要在matlab中进行GPSR算法实现的用户,这份资料将大有裨益。
用户头像
西门镜湖
2025.02.20
GPSR 6.0l1有化算法文档深入浅出,非常适合进行matlab开发和算法研究的工程师。
用户头像
黄涵奕
2025.02.19
文档对GPSR 6.0算法的介绍详细,尤其在l1有化方面的matlab实现具有指导意义。
用户头像
Orca是只鲸
2025.01.01
这款GPSR 6.0的算法在matlab上的应用非常便捷高效,针对l1有化算法进行了优化。